Potentilla gelida subsp. boreo-asiatica Jurtz. & Kamelin
Publ. & Syn.Jurtz. & Kamelin, Fl. Arct. URSS 9, 1: 320, 220 (1984). Holotype (LE): Siberia: "Regio ripae dextrae fl. Jenisei in cursu inferiore adjacens, tundra inter fl. Dagyldykan et fl. Czopko", 22. July 1914, leg. N.I. Kuznetzov and V.V. Reverdatto.
NotesYurtsev: Subspecies boreo-asiatica is a northern race with a huge range from the Urals and Cis-Ural hillocky plain east to South Chukotka. It differs from the Caucasian subsp. gelida in several characters including shape and dissection of leaves (approaching the leaf shape of Aquilegia), shape of stipules, sepals, and epicalyx segments, etc.
Chromosomes28 (4x). - Siberia (N), Far East (N). - Several reports.
GeographyAsian (N): RUS SIB RFE.
